70 vision in a wide arc for a token price of 200mp/10fu is already better than most other recon unit in the game, except for a vetted 222 or 251 with spotting scopes but those are doctrinal, significantly more expensive and harder to get.
Numbers can be tweaked a bit further for sure but I think most people are underestimating how good 70 vision range already is. Especially considering it's a stock unit.
yeah but now compare this unit with a Kubel. You pay 10 more fuel for a unit that has a bit more sight range but is forced to be static, has an annoying setup time, has worse mobility, cannot fight, cannot cap territory, and whose minimap detection ability is arguably worse. The HT also has to stand in the open, but a Kubel can just drive behind a shotblocker and use vet1 ability in case of danger. Absolutely not worth it if you ask me.
Honestly I think the very best solution for this would be to add veterancy to the IR HT

So it becomes stronger and more interesting over time but you have to work for it. Ofc with shared veterancy and 20-30% lower veterancy requirements than a Kubel.
The veterancy could look like this for example:
Vet 1: +5 sight range when static
Vet 2: +1.5 speed, +1.2 acceleration, +4 rotation (unit has now better mobility than vet 0 kubel, but worse mobility than vet 2 kubel)
Vet 3: +5 sight range when static, -50% searchlight setup time
Vet 4: "Detection" ability cost from 10 to 5... or Detection becomes now passive
Vet 5: +10 frontal armor, +5 rear armor
